#1c3341 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c3341 is composed of 11% red, 20%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 202.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 18.2%. #1c3341 color hex could be obtained by blending #386682 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#1c3341 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

#1c3341 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1c3341 has RGB values of R:28, G:51,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 1848129.

Hex triplet 1c3341 #1c3341
RGB Decimal 28, 51, 65 rgb(28,51,65)
RGB Percent 11, 20, 25.5 rgb(11%,20%,25.5%)
CMYK 57, 22, 0, 75
HSL 202.7°, 39.8, 18.2 hsl(202.7,39.8%,18.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 202.7°, 56.9, 25.5
Web Safe 333333 #333333
CIE-LAB 20.028, -4.318, -11.55
XYZ 2.617, 2.996, 5.441
xyY 0.237, 0.271, 2.996
CIE-LCH 20.028, 12.331, 249.499
CIE-LUV 20.028, -8.851, -12.037
Hunter-Lab 17.309, -3.307, -6.522
Binary 00011100, 00110011, 01000001

Shades and Tints of #1c3341

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080a is the darkest color, while #fbf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c3341

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2f2f is the less saturated color, while #03395a is the most saturated one.
